In the economy of sports teams, MLB teams are the hardest teams to support and need the largest financial and population bases.
Indianapolis has an MSA of ~1.7 million. While that is enough to support an MLB team alone, when you factor in that Indianapolis already has 2 other pro teams, the market saturation is just about right for the size. If you start adding in more teams you will dilute the amount of money that can spread to each team, making them financially not feasible.
Besides the basic economics of adding in a new team, Indianapolis is in no position financially to build a new stadium...the city got raped by the Colts and it be a long time before the city spends large amounts of money on yet another sports venue.
